#5f0956 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5f0956 is composed of 37.3% red, 3.5%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.5% magenta, 9.5% yellow and 62.7% black. It has a hue angle of 306.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 20.4%. #5f0956 color hex could be obtained by blending #be12ac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#5f0956 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5f0956 has RGB values of R:95, G:9,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.09,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 6228310.

Shades and Tints of #5f0956

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050105 is the darkest color, while #fef2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5f0956

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373136 is the less saturated color, while #67015c is the most saturated one.
